Today, on the First Sunday of the civil New Year, we celebrate The Epiphany of the Lord (主顯節). In this Solemnity, we celebrate the visit of the wise men and the manifestation of Jesus' kingship to all the nations. We are blessed that with this celebration, we, who are Gentiles, are called to participate in the life with God through Jesus Christ. Let us treasure this blessing and resolve to be faithful to the Lord always.

Today, we celebrate the Feast of St. John, Apostle & Evangelist (聖若望宗徒(聖史)慶日). St. John is known as the Beloved Disciple. In the Gospel attributed to him, he is referred to as the disciple that Jesus loved, and in his letters, he wrote about the love of God for us and how we are also all called to love God. Let us listen to his teaching of love and live this love in our lives.

Feast of Saint John, Apostle and evangelist - December 27, 2021 - Liturgical Calendar Today is the third day in the Octave of Christmas. The Church celebrates the Feast of St. John, Apostle and evangelist. Born in Bethsaida, he was called while mending his nets to follow Jesus. He became the beloved disciple of Jesus. He wrote the fourth Gospel, three Epistles and the Apocalypse.

On this Third Sunday of Advent, we see the people's reaction to St. John the Baptist's "voice in the desert". St. John the Baptist told them to share what they have and to stop the evil that they were doing. The same call continues to echo to us today. We are called again and again to prepare for God's coming to our hearts. Have we done our best to do so?
